Jumping The Broom

Broom largely isn’t a broad comedy, it still rarely goes for restraint in anything but tone. The story requires Devine and Bassett to overplay their hands as cartoonish harridans, while Patton constructs half the story’s drama by behaving like a brittle, spoiled child and repeatedly threatening to cancel the wedding if it can’t play out according to her fantasies. But how much of a stake do viewers have in whether two recent acquaintances complete a rushed wedding for questionable reasons?

Scream 4

Scream 4 is an incredibly valiant effort. The whole series was born to flip a genre on its head and this film certainly succeeds in both reinventing the franchise and introducing a slew of new ideas to the already well-known story. It just should have concentrated more on that instead of all its excess. The excess is undoubtedly fun, especially if you’ve enjoyed the other films in the franchise, but it doesn’t quite cover up all of the problems.
